更多"若有以下函数首部int fun(double X[10],int *"的相关试题:
[单项选择]若有以下函数首部 int fun(double x[lO],int *n) 则下面针对此函数的函数声明语句中正确的是______。
A. int fun(double x, int *;
B. int fun(double, in;
C. int fun(double *x, int ;
D. iht fun(double*,int*);
[单项选择]若有以下函数首部int fun(double X[10],int *n)则下面针对此函数的函数声明语句中正确的是【 】。
A. int fun(double X,int *n);
B. int fun(double ,int);
C. int fun(double * X,int n);
D. int fun(double *int*);
[单项选择]若有以下函数首部 int fun(double x[10],int *n) 则下面针对此函数的函数声明语句中正确的是
A. int fun(double x,int *;
B. int fun(double ,in;
C. int fun(double *x,int ;
D. int fun(double *,int *);
[单项选择]若有以下函数首部: int fun(double x[10],int *n) 则下面针对此函数的函数声明语句中正确的是( )。
A. int fun(double x, int *;
B. int fun(double, in;
C. int fun(double *x, int ;
D. int fun(double*, int*);
[单项选择]有以下函数定义:
int fun(double a,double b)
return a*b;
若以下选项中所用变量都已正确定义并赋值,错误的函数调用是( )。
A. if(fun(x,y))……
B. z=fun(fun(x,y),fun(x,y));
C. z=fun(fun(x,y)x,y);
D. fun(x,y);
[单项选择]若有函数
Viod fun(double a[], int *n)
{………}
以下叙述中正确的是( )。
A. 调用fun函数时只有数组执行按值传送,其他实参和形参之间执行按地址传送
B. 形参a和n都是指针变量
C. 形参a是一个数组名,n是指针变量
D. 调用fun函数时将把double型实参数组元素一一对应地传送给形参a数组
[单项选择]有以下程序
int fun1(double a){ return a*=a; }
int fun2(double x,double y)
{ double a=0,b=0;
a=fun1(x);b=fun1(y); return(int)(a+b);
}
main( )
{double w;w=fun2(1.1,2.0);……}
程序执行后变量w中的值是______。
A. 5.21
B. 5
C. 5
D. 0
[单项选择]有以下程序: int fun1(double A) {return a*=a;} int fun2(double x,double y) { double a=0,b=0; a=fun1(x);b=funl(y); return(int)(a+B) ; } main( ) { double w;w=fun2(1.1,2.0);……} 程序执行后变量w中的值是( )。
A. 5.21
B. 5
C. 5.0
D. 0.0
[单项选择]有下列函数定义:
int fun(double a,double B)
{return a*b;}
若下列选项中所用变量都已正确定义并赋值,错误的函数调用是( )。
A. if(fun(x,){……}
B. z=fun(fun(x,,fun(x,);
C. z=fun(fun(x,x,;
D. fun(x,;
[单项选择]有以下程序 int fun1(double a){return a*=a;} int fun2(double x,double y) {double a=0,b=0; a=fun1(x);b=fun1(y);return(int)(a+b); } main( ) {double w;w=fun2(1.1,2.0);…} 程序执行后变量w中的值是
A. 5.21
B. 5
C. 5.0
D. 0.0
[单项选择]有以下程序:
int fun1(double
A. return a*=a;
B. ;
C. 5.0
D. 0.0